Description

The Idrive Transfer Point is used to provide WiFi coverage for remote parking areas to facilitate download of Idrive X1 devices. The downloads are transferred to the Idrive Base Station over a virtual private network (VPN).

Options

The basic Transfer Point consists of a Weatherproof enclosure containing VPN Router with a built in WiFi Access point. For additional Wifi coverage the Transfer point can accomodate up to two more Wifi access points

Installation

Mounting

The Transfer Point may be mounted to the side of a building, pole or other structure. It should be mounted at a height which allows for line of site to the vehicles which are to be downloaded. (Typically 12 - 20 feet off of the ground)

There are four mounting holes two on either side of the Terminal Point. That you can use to strew or bolted it securely to a flat surface.

Connecting 120V Power

Note: All power connection should meet state and local codes!


1)Once it is mounted you'll need to run power to your Terminal Point. (Mount it how?)

2) There is a through wall fitting in the bottom center of the Terminal Point. This is set up so you can run three wire flexible conduit for power to your Terminal Point. Once you have connected the flexible conduit to the Terminal Point and you have your wiring in.

3) You will then find at the bottom of the Terminal Point a terminal block. Covered by a clear plastic shield remove the two screws securing the shield. Connect the wires to the terminal block using supplied connectors. Starting left to right (neutral wire, ground wire, hot wire) replace shield cover.

Requirements

120V AC power

Internet Connection with a Fixed IP Address
